Jobstore are recruiting for dedicated and reliable Site Support Operatives to join our clients retail team. The successful candidate will play a vital role in maintaining the smooth operation of the site by providing essential customer support across various functions. This position offers an excellent opportunity for individuals seeking hands-on experience in a dynamic retail environment, with responsibilities that contribute directly to the efficiency and safety of the operations. We are initially looking for Weekend Operatives to work shifts between 10.00am and 9.00pm and will be looking for weekday operatives within the next week. Please state your preference on your application.

Duties

  • Assist with general car park management and trolley retrieval.
  • Support site maintenance and organisation to ensure a safe and clean working environment.
  • Support operational teams by preparing and distributing trolleys, cages and equipment as required.
  • Conduct routine inspections of site facilities and report any issues or hazards promptly.
  • Help with loading and unloading materials, ensuring proper handling and storage.
  • Maintain accurate records of activities undertaken and report on progress to supervisors.

Skills

  • Good organisational skills with the ability to prioritise tasks effectively.
  • Strong communication skills to liaise with team members and management.
  • Be physically fit and able to work on your feet all shift.
  • Basic knowledge of health and safety regulations relevant to site operations.
  • Ability to work independently as well as part of a team in a fast-paced environment.
  • Physical fitness to perform manual tasks such as lifting, carrying, and standing for extended periods.
  • A proactive attitude with attention to detail and a commitment to safety standards.
